Kaedah untuk menguji sama ada port boleh diakses di Linux termasuk menggunakan arahan telnet, menggunakan arahan nc, menggunakan arahan ping, menggunakan arahan ncat dan menggunakan arahan curl. Pengenalan terperinci: 1. Gunakan arahan telnet ialah alat baris arahan yang digunakan untuk log masuk jauh dan menguji sambungan rangkaian Anda boleh menggunakan arahan telnet untuk menguji sama ada port yang ditentukan tersedia; alat baris arahan yang digunakan untuk penyahpepijatan rangkaian dan alat baris perintah, yang boleh digunakan untuk menguji ketersambungan port 3. Gunakan arahan ping, dsb.
Sistem pengendalian tutorial ini: sistem linux6.4.3, komputer DELL G3.
Sebagai pengaturcara, saya berbesar hati untuk menerangkan kepada anda cara menguji sama ada port dibuka di Linux. Di Linux, terdapat beberapa cara untuk menguji ketersambungan port. Berikut adalah beberapa kaedah yang biasa digunakan:
1 Gunakan arahan telnet: telnet ialah alat baris arahan yang digunakan untuk log masuk jauh dan menguji sambungan rangkaian. Anda boleh menggunakan arahan telnet untuk menguji sama ada port yang ditentukan tersedia. Sebagai contoh, untuk menguji sama ada port 80 hos dengan alamat IP 192.168.0.1 tersedia, anda boleh melaksanakan arahan berikut:
telnet 192.168.0.1 80
Jika port tersedia, anda akan melihat gesaan bahawa sambungan berjaya. Jika port tidak tersedia, anda akan melihat mesej sambungan gagal.
2. Gunakan arahan nc: nc (netcat) ialah alat baris arahan untuk penyahpepijatan dan ujian rangkaian. Ia boleh digunakan untuk menguji sambungan port. Contohnya, untuk menguji sama ada port 80 hos dengan alamat IP 192.168.0.1 tersedia, anda boleh melaksanakan arahan berikut:
nc -zv 192.168.0.1 80
Jika port tersedia, anda akan melihat mesej sambungan yang berjaya. Jika port tidak tersedia, anda akan melihat mesej sambungan gagal.
3. Gunakan arahan ping: ping ialah alat baris arahan yang digunakan untuk menguji ketersambungan rangkaian. Walaupun ping digunakan terutamanya untuk menguji kebolehcapaian hos, ia juga boleh digunakan untuk menguji ketersambungan port. Sebagai contoh, untuk menguji sama ada port 80 hos dengan alamat IP 192.168.0.1 tersedia, anda boleh melaksanakan arahan berikut:
ping 192.168.0.1 -p 80
Jika port tersedia, anda akan melihat tindak balas arahan ping. Jika port tidak tersedia, anda akan melihat mesej Tidak Dapat Sambung.
4. Gunakan perintah ncat: ncat ialah alat rangkaian dan versi perintah nc yang dipertingkat. Ia menawarkan lebih banyak ciri dan pilihan, termasuk menguji sambungan port. Sebagai contoh, untuk menguji sama ada port 80 hos dengan alamat IP 192.168.0.1 tersedia, anda boleh melaksanakan arahan berikut:
ncat -vz 192.168.0.1 80
Jika port tersedia, anda akan melihat mesej sambungan yang berjaya. Jika port tidak tersedia, anda akan melihat mesej sambungan gagal.
5. Gunakan arahan curl: curl ialah alat baris arahan yang digunakan untuk menghantar permintaan HTTP dan menguji sambungan rangkaian. Walaupun digunakan terutamanya untuk permintaan HTTP, ia juga boleh digunakan untuk menguji sambungan port. Sebagai contoh, untuk menguji sama ada port 80 hos dengan alamat IP 192.168.0.1 tersedia, anda boleh melaksanakan arahan berikut:
curl -I 192.168.0.1:80
Jika port tersedia, anda akan melihat maklumat pengepala respons HTTP. Jika port tidak tersedia, anda akan melihat mesej sambungan gagal.
Kaedah ini hanyalah beberapa cara biasa untuk menguji ketersambungan port dalam Linux. Bergantung pada keperluan khusus anda dan persekitaran rangkaian, alat atau pilihan tambahan mungkin diperlukan. Jika anda memerlukan maklumat yang lebih terperinci, adalah disyorkan untuk merujuk manual manual Linux atau merujuk kepada dokumen yang berkaitan.
Ringkasnya, terdapat banyak cara untuk menguji sama ada port dibuka di Linux, termasuk menggunakan arahan telnet, arahan nc, arahan ping, arahan ncat dan arahan curl, dll. Alat ini boleh membantu anda menyemak sambungan port dengan cepat untuk penyahpepijatan rangkaian dan penyelesaian masalah.
Atas ialah kandungan terperinci Bagaimana untuk menguji sama ada port boleh diakses di Linux.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!